Title:
THE BUCKLING OF STIFFENED AND UNSTIFFENED CONICAL AND CYLINDRICAL SHELLS
Corporate Author:
TECHNION RESEARCH AND DEVELOPMENT FOUNDATION LTD HAIFA (ISRAEL) EORD DIV
Report Date:
1969-10-01
Abstract:
Theoretical and experimental research on the buckling of stiffened and unstiffened conical and cylindrical shells, carried out over a period of 3 years, is summarized. The topics of earlier work are outlined and the more recent topics are summarized. These include discreteness effect in stringer-stiffened shells and the effect of elastic restraint on panels and sub-shells the influence of inplane boundary conditions for ring-stiffened cylindrical shells extensive tests on stringer-stiffened cylindrical shells under axial compression and ring stiffened conical shells under torsion and also thermal buckling of cylindrical shells.
